For branch managers of Corvane Retail Group: the finance review has provisionally approved a training budget of 840K for next year, a 9% increase. Allocation favours customer-service accreditation at the Dellbrook and Asherton branches, with a reserve of 60K held centrally for mid-year needs. Spend against the Wrenfield Academy contract was under plan this year, and unused credits roll forward. Final sign-off is expected at the December committee. The confidential note below explains the strategic context.

internal memo for kawip-hadug: Headcount on the Wenwyn team goes from 7 to 140 by the end of January. Gross margin on Wenwyn came in at 20 percent against a plan of 15 percent.

Hi Dara — handing this one to you. The replacement lock for the records safe finally came in from Kestrel Lockworks. It's boxed in the secure cage, tagged for the Aldmere office. The fitter expects it before noon Friday, so it needs to go on tomorrow's run at the latest. Don't let it sit on the open dock. For the courier hand-over, follow the line below.

handover note for yagef-bagep: the drudor pelius courier leaves the kasdor zorvan norir ledger at gate 8016 under passcode 755406

### Alert: SDK Parity Gap

The Wrenfield JavaScript SDK v4.2 shipped batch uploads; the Kotlin SDK has not. Customers calling batch endpoints from Kotlin get 501 responses. This is expected, not an outage. Do not file incident tickets. Tell affected customers Kotlin parity lands next release. Track impacted accounts in the parity spreadsheet. For questions or customer-facing wording, contact the SDK team at the address below.

alerts address for kajog-tadup: druox@plorvanet.internal